1. Consider the Occasion
The first step in choosing the right shoes for any outfit is to consider the occasion and dress code. Different events and settings call for different styles of shoes, so it’s important to match your footwear to the overall tone and formality of the occasion.
For example, opt for sleek and sophisticated heels or dress shoes for formal events like weddings or business meetings, while casual outings may call for comfortable sneakers or sandals.
2. Coordinate with the Style and Color Palette
When selecting shoes to pair with your outfit, consider the overall style and color palette to ensure a cohesive look. Choose shoes that complement the aesthetic of your outfit, whether it’s classic, modern, bohemian, or eclectic.
Additionally, aim to coordinate the color of your shoes with the dominant hues in your outfit, opting for complementary or contrasting tones that enhance the overall visual impact.
3. Pay Attention to Proportions
The proportion of your shoes can greatly influence the overall balance and silhouette of your outfit. Consider the length and width of your pants, skirts, or dresses when selecting shoes to ensure they complement your body shape and proportions.
For example, opt for sleek and streamlined shoes like pumps or ankle boots to elongate the legs when wearing cropped pants or midi skirts, while chunky or platform shoes can add balance to oversized or voluminous silhouettes.
4. Choose the Right Height and Heel Type
The height and heel type of your shoes can also impact your comfort and posture, as well as the overall aesthetic of your outfit. Consider your personal preferences, comfort level, and the demands of the occasion when selecting heel heights and styles.
Opt for lower heels or flats for all-day comfort and practicality, while stiletto heels or platforms can add height and glamour to evening wear or special occasions.
5. Balance Comfort and Style
While style is undoubtedly important when choosing shoes for an outfit, it’s equally essential to prioritize comfort and functionality.
Pay attention to factors such as cushioning, arch support, and the materials of your shoes to ensure a comfortable fit and minimize the risk of discomfort or foot pain. Experiment with different styles, brands, and sizes to find shoes that not only look great but also feel great to wear.
6. Experiment with Texture and Detail
Don’t be afraid to have fun and experiment with texture, pattern, and embellishments when choosing shoes for your outfit. Consider incorporating shoes with interesting textures like suede, patent leather, or metallic finishes to add visual interest and depth to your look.
Likewise, opt for shoes with unique details such as studs, embroidery, or embellishments to make a statement and showcase your personal style.
7. Invest in Versatile Classics
When building a shoe wardrobe, it’s essential to invest in versatile classics that can be paired with a variety of outfits and occasions.
Timeless styles like black pumps, nude flats, white sneakers, and ankle boots are wardrobe staples that offer endless styling possibilities and can effortlessly transition from day to night, casual to formal, and season to season.
